**Action Item (for weekly sync):** So the Pedalwick rebalancing tool had a fun one — it kept routing vans to depots that were already full because the capacity cache only refreshed hourly. Crews wasted about 30 van-hours last week. We're cutting cache TTL to five minutes and adding a staleness warning in the dispatch UI. Owner: platform squad, due end of sprint. Please skim the incident notes before the sync so we can close this fast; they're posted here.

operations page: https://vault.qorvelcorp.example/settings

## Environment Variables — TumbleVault Access Flow

This page covers the variables the TumbleVault locker service reads at startup. Most control behavior support can safely adjust: `LOCKER_HOLD_MINUTES`, `QR_EXPIRY_SECONDS`, and `NOTIFY_RETRY_COUNT` are all documented below with their defaults. One variable is sensitive and must never be pasted into tickets or chat: the credential used to authorize door-release calls against the Hingeworks controller. When provisioning a new node, open the `.env` file and add this line:

sealed setting: ARCHIVE_KEY3=8d0

**Release checklist — Profile Shard Cutover**

Hey plugin folks! Before we ship Lanternbox 4.2, double-check that your plugin doesn't cache raw profile IDs, because the user-profile store is being split across eight shards this cycle. Lookups via the official ProfileFetch API are unaffected, but anything hitting the old monolith endpoint will start 404ing after the cutover. Run your integration suite against the staging shard ring and confirm green before Thursday. If anything looks weird, reference the staging build below in your report.

pipeline stamp: htk4_ae36